Shalom beloved. Another one of my favorite scriptures today, Psalm number one, verse three, the Psalmist is speaking about somebody that roots their life in God as their source. And the Psalmist gives us the promise that when God is our source, no matter what is going on around us, whether you have a job, don't have a job. Whether you're young, whether you're old, whether the country is under Republican control or Democratic control, whether the stock market is up and down, when we're rooted in the Lord, we're gonna be fruitful.

Listen to what the Psalmist writes, "The person that roots themselves in the Lord will be like a tree firmly planted by streams of water, which yields its fruit in season. And its leaf does not wither. And in whatever he does, he prospers". Jesus said he, that abides in me bears much fruit. We need to make it our aim to go deep into the waters of eternal life. You see, the Lord's spirit dwells beneath the surface. If you go, for example, to the very bottom of an ocean, regardless of what is happening on the surface of the ocean, perhaps there's a big storm going through and there's tremendous 16 foot waves on the surface at the bottom, it's calm. It's a totally different atmosphere.

The same thing is true when we learn how to go deep in the spirit of the Lord, we call in Hebrew, the Ruach HaKodesh. As we endeavor to root ourselves in eternity, to root ourselves in the timeless one, to make our first priority, to build our relationship with God, by drawing near to him, by talking to him every day from our spirit, from our heart, by seeking to be sensitive to the leading of the spirit in our life, by putting him first, what happens is the roots of our faith go deeper and deeper so that we come to a place that there's a continual flow of living water that's flowing out of us, regardless of what's happening in the surface of your life.

It's an awesome thing to know that no matter what happens, you're gonna be fruitful in the Lord. And this promise is available to anyone that will put Jesus first in their life.
